You can distinguish hardwood pallets from softwood pallets by examining the wood grain and texture. Hardwood pallets, made from trees like oak or maple, typically have a finer, denser grain and a smoother finish, while softwood pallets, made from trees like pine or spruce, tend to have a coarser grain and lighter weight. Additionally, hardwoods are usually darker and more durable, while softwoods are lighter and may have visible knots. Finally, you can often identify the type of wood by its smell when cut or sanded.
